Neighborhood Overview

Bali Hai Golf Club is strategically situated at the southern end of the iconic Las Vegas Strip, offering a unique blend of natural beauty and urban convenience. This prime location provides easy access to major thoroughfares like I-15 and the 796/Blue Diamond Road exit, making arrival straightforward. Parking is ample and typically well-organized on-site, with clear signage directing players. For those flying in, McCarran International Airport (LAS), now Harry Reid International Airport, is a mere 5-10 minute drive away, depending on traffic. This proximity means you can often play a round shortly after landing or before departing. Rideshare services and taxis are readily available throughout the Strip, offering convenient transportation options to and from the course. For a smooth entry, aim to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before your scheduled tee time to allow for check-in, rental club collection, and a brief visit to the practice facilities, especially during peak tournament or holiday periods.

Bali Hai Golf Club

On site

Bali Hai Golf Club is a premier golf destination designed by Brian Curley and Lee Schmidt, offering a unique tropical paradise experience amidst the Las Vegas desert. This 7,002-yard, par-72 championship course is renowned for its lush landscaping, including over 100,000 tropical plants, 2,500 coconut palms, and a mile of white sand bunkers. Water features are abundant, coming into play on 11 holes, adding both beauty and strategic challenge. The course boasts immaculate Tifway Bermuda fairways and greens, ensuring a high-quality playing surface. Amenities include a championship golf shop, private lessons, and a stunning clubhouse with a bar and grill, making it a comprehensive golf resort experience right on the Strip.

Topgolf Las Vegas

0.8 mi

Topgolf offers a unique entertainment experience that combines the sport of golf with a lively social atmosphere. Located a short distance from Bali Hai, it features climate-controlled hitting bays where groups can enjoy microchipped golf balls that score themselves, along with music, food, and drinks. It's an ideal venue for players of all skill levels, whether you want to practice your swing or just have fun with friends. Beyond the bays, Topgolf boasts multiple bars, a full-service restaurant, and event spaces, making it a versatile spot for casual outings and celebrations.

Bali Hai Clubhouse Bar & Grill

On site

The Bali Hai Clubhouse Bar & Grill offers a convenient and scenic dining experience directly at the golf club. Overlooking the 18th hole, it provides a relaxed atmosphere perfect for enjoying breakfast, lunch, or post-round drinks. The menu features American fare with a tropical twist, including sandwiches, salads, and popular breakfast items. It’s the ideal spot for golfers to refuel with a quick bite, enjoy a refreshing beverage, or celebrate a successful round without having to leave the property. The bar area is also a great place to catch up on sports scores.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Las Vegas is generally mild, with daytime temperatures averaging in the 50s and 60s. While comfortable for golf, mornings and evenings can be quite cool, so layering is recommended. Pack sweaters, light jackets, and comfortable long pants for your rounds. The sun still shines, but the air has a crispness that is refreshing after the summer heat.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ring and early summer bring increasingly warm and pleasant weather, ideal for outdoor activities. Daytime temperatures steadily climb from the 70s into the 90s by late spring. It's a perfect time for golf, but you'll want to start incorporating sun protection like hats, sunglasses, and sunscreen. Light, breathable golf attire is comfortable, and early tee times are still preferable to avoid the peak afternoon sun.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er (July-August) is the hottest period in Las Vegas, with temperatures frequently soaring above 100°F. Golfing during these months requires extreme caution and preparation. Hydration is paramount, and players should utilize the beverage cart services regularly. Early morning tee times are almost mandatory to play in bearable conditions. Lightweight, moisture-wicking clothing, wide-brimmed hats, and plenty of sunscreen are essential.

🍂

Fall season

Fall offers a welcome return to more comfortable temperatures, as the intense summer heat subsides. Daytime highs typically range from the 70s to the 90s in early fall, cooling down into the 60s and 70s by late October and November. This season is excellent for golf, providing enjoyable playing conditions. Layers are still a good idea, as mornings can be cool before warming up considerably under the desert sun.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is infrequent in Las Vegas, typically occurring during the winter months in short, intense bursts, and is rare otherwise. Snowfall is exceptionally uncommon and usually melts upon contact. If rain does occur during your visit, it might lead to temporary course closures or delays. However, most rounds can continue with appropriate rain gear. The dry climate means that even moderate temperatures can feel warm, but humidity is usually low.
